Pengertian
debian router adalah adalah PC yang sudah di install sistem operasi debian yang akan di gunakan untuk mengatur lalu lintas/sebagai Router.di debian router ini sama halnya dengan perangkat router seperti Mikrotik,Junaiper atau Cisco di debian router ini Fungsi utama Router adalah merutekan paket (informasi). Sebuah Router memiliki kemampuan Routing, artinya Router secara cerdas dapat mengetahui kemana rute perjalanan informasi (paket) akan dilewatkan, apakah ditujukan untuk host lain yang satu network ataukah berada di network yang berbeda. Jika paket-paket ditujukan untuk host pada network lain maka router akan meneruskannya ke network tersebut. Sebaliknya, jika paket-paket ditujukan untuk host yang satu network maka router akan menghalangi paket-paket keluar.
Latar belakang
karena tugas sekolah membuat PC yang terinstall OS debian menjadi Router(Debian Router)
Tujuan
membuat debian Router dengan siatem operasi Debian
Alat dan bahan
1 buah PC untuk debian Routernya
1PC untuk client
Koneksi internet
Waktu pelaksanaan
1 hari
Tahap pelaksanaan
Pertama kita masuk ke #nano /etc/network/interfaces
(untuk menambah ip eth0 dan ip eth1 dan juga dns nameserver)
disitu saya menambahkan
ip eth1(ip yang menuju internet)
ip eth0(ip yang menuju lokal)
dns-nameserver dari google/dari ISP
Jika sudah selesai kita save dengan ctrl+x kemudian tekan y lalu enter
Kemudian tuliskan perintah #nano /etc/sysctl.conf untuk mengaktifkan ip forward dengan menghilangkan tanda pagar net.ip4.ip_forward=1
kemudian ketikkan perintah #nano /proc/sys/net/ipv4/ip_forward (untuk mengganti ip forward yang sebelumnya 0 menjadi 1)
jika sudah selesai save dengan ctrl+x kemudian tekan y lalu enter
Kemudian kita ketik perintah #nano /etc/rc.local (bertujuan supaya konfigurasi iptables yang telah kita ketikan di konsoletadi tidak hilang ketika router kita di restart. Jadi konfigurasi ini bisa dilakukan atau tidak. Supaya, kita tidak menuliskan lagi setelah router kita di restart lebih baik kita tuliskan saja konfigurasi iptables pada file /etc/rc.local.)
tambahkan perintah iptables -t nat -A POSTROUTING -o eth1 -j MASQUERADE (pilih interface yang menuju internet)
jika sudah selesai save dengan ctrl+x kemudian tekan y lalu enter
Dalam konfigurasi diatas pasti teman teman pada penasaran dengan apasih arti dari -t , -A dan lain lain.Untuk itu silahkan teman teman mengetikan perintah man iptables ,lalu akan muncul keterangan dari konfigurasi tadi,kita juga bisa mengubah konfigurasi kita sesuai kebutuhan dan prosedur yang ada dalam man iptables tadi
kemudian coba ping menggunakan pc client dan pastikan terhubung ke internet
Kesimpulan
dengan debian router kita bisa memberi sumber atau tujuan paket yang akan di kirim atau diterima
Referensi
http://www.uptoayuning.io/2016/08/konfigurasi-iptables-pada-debian-pc.html